suppose i have a small car pic based with 2 dc motors using pic16f84A controlled with a wire controller which move forward, backward, left and right.
what i can do?
I did something like this using a Cypress WirelessUSB module (CYWUSB6935 to be specific), a PIC18F4550, and a run-down R/C car shell with a broken receiver. I would recommended switching to at least a 16F628A for an application such as this. The wireless code alone took over a kilobyte or two of program memory, so you will want to have plenty of room
